Plant Manager | Chemicals

International Recruitment Centre Pte. Ltd.

International Recruitment Centre Pte. Ltd. company logo

On behalf of our client, we are looking for a suitable personnel to join them as Factory Manager.


Summary


This role requires a strong understanding of

  1. chemical processes
  2. production management
  3. people management, and
  4. safety protocols



Responsibilities:

Production and Operations:

  • Overseeing the production process: This involves planning, scheduling, and executing production runs to meet deadlines and quality standards.
  • Managing staff: Hiring, training, and leading a team of chemical technicians, operators, and other production personnel.
  • Optimizing plant operations: Ensuring efficient use of equipment and resources to minimize waste and production costs.
  • Monitoring production metrics: Keeping track of key performance indicators (KPIs) to identify areas for improvement and address any production issues.

Safety and Quality Control:

  • Enforcing safety regulations: Implementing and adhering to strict safety protocols to prevent accidents and injuries.
  • Ensures product quality: Maintaining a rigorous quality control program to guarantee that produced chemicals meet specifications.

Other Responsibilities:

  • Budget management: Developing and maintaining production budgets.
  • Environmental compliance: Ensuring the plant operates by environmental regulations.
  • Keeps abreast of new technologies and industry best practices.
  • To manage the various teams in the factory



Qualifications/Requirements:

  • A bachelor's degree in Chemical Engineering (organic Chemical or fine Chemical) or related discipline.
  • Minimum 10 years of experience in chemical manufacturing operations (preferably agrochemical manufacturing operations).
  • Strong leadership, communication, and problem-solving skills are necessary.
  • In-depth knowledge of safety regulations and quality control procedures is crucial.
  • Strong working knowledge in chemical plant management (preferably agrochemical plant).
  • Experience in managing or participating in ISO certification processes is advantageous
  • Able to speak and communicate in Chinese/Mandarin
  • Willing to base in Malaysia or travel between Singapore and Malaysia frequently
  • This person will be required to station in China for a period to understudy the manufacturing process for the hiring company's specific product.
